Head Start Birth-5 has an opening for a full-time Disabilities and Behavioral Health Specialist working 35 hours per week. This position is responsible for providing training observing children developing strategies and assisting with disabilities and challenging behaviors. Develop implement and maintain positive working relationships with area Local Education Agencies and Part C agencies to ensure high quality services for children with IEP/IFSP and/or behavioral health needs. Monitor IEP/IFSP information developmental and social emotional screening results and other data affecting disability and mental health services. Provide support and model strategies with participants families and staff with IEP/IFSP Positive Support Plans or Behavioral Management Plans. Presence at each Head Start facility is required frequently on an as-needed basis and/or as directed. This position will complete duties and responsibilities as they relate to the Head Start Performance Standards Indiana Day Care Licensing Regulations CACFP Guidelines and Head Start Birth-5 Forms and Procedures Manual.
A graduate of an accredited college or university with at least an Associates Degree in Early Childhood Education Special Education Psychology or correlated discipline or enrolled in an accredited college or university leading to an Associates Degree in Early Childhood Education Special Education Psychology or correlated discipline is required. Three or more years experience in early childhood education special education and/or mental health may be considered. Bachelors degree knowledge of child development and preschool experience preferred.
Must meet Head Start and Indiana Childcare Licensing Regulations including Head Start Standards of Conduct federal and state criminal history requirements sex offender registry checks drug screen physical and complete an annual T.B. test.
